Slow Cooker Beer Bratwurst with Onions & Peppers
#### How to Make Slow Cooker Beer Bratwurst with Onions & Peppers
ADVERTISEMENT
1. **Layer the bottom** of your slow cooker with sliced onions and peppers.
2. **Place the bratwursts** on top of the veggies.
3. **Pour beer** over the sausages and vegetables until mostly covered.
4. **Season** with garlic, salt, pepper, and any herbs you like.
5. **Cook on low** for 6–8 hours, or on high for 3–4 hours, until the bratwursts are tender and fully cooked.
6. Optional: For a nice finish, briefly **grill or sear** the bratwursts to crisp the skins before serving.
#### Serving Suggestions
Serve your beer bratwurst and peppers on a toasted bun with mustard, alongside crispy fries or a fresh green salad. A side of sauerkraut or pickles adds a tangy contrast that complements the rich flavors perfectly.
